APC Radio: Arrest APC leaders, says PDP

By Samuel Ogidan
Abuja

Peoples Democratic Party Presidential Campaign Organisation (PDPPCO) has called State Security Service (SSS), the Police and other security agencies to arrest and question Muhammadu Buhari, Ahmed Bola Tinubu, Rotimi Amaechi, Kayode Fayemi and Yusuf Mamman for operating illegal radio station known as APC Radio or Radio Chanji.

The campaign organisation also said the opposition party had budgeted $2 million for a documentary to tarnish the image of President Goodluck Jonathan.
Briefing newsmen yesterday in Abuja at a press conference, the Director of Media and Publicity of PDPPCO, Femi Fani-Kayode, said Ambassador Yusuf Mamman, an APC leader and stalwart had been given millions of dollars to start the illegal radio station to fight Jonathan’s government after the opposition loses the election.

It said: “The objective of the radio station is to serve as a propaganda tool to fight the government after they lose the elections on March 28. The brain behind the operation is the former governor of Ekiti state, Kayode Fayemi, who equally founded Radio Kudirat during the days of NADECO when the government of General Sani Abacha was being fought by a number of people in Nigeria.”
The documentary, which he said is titled ‘’Nigerians…What Is Going On.”

according to him would be sub-headed “$15 million US Private Jet Arms Scandal; N5 trillion stolen under Jonathan; N21 billion Pension funds embezzled; N10 billion private jet scandal; N1.6 trillion oil subsidy scandal, and much more.”
